Output e2f60c79d07c68d053fb223cbe1a7f297fd2261b57d5178656e2af3452fb1601:1

value
24432535
script pubkey
OP_0 OP_PUSHBYTES_20 7dc5d7162ecf335f5cb7d28d308cb4b7e6b692e3
address
bc1q0hzaw93weue47h9h62xnpr95klntdyhrt54wrn
transaction
e2f60c79d07c68d053fb223cbe1a7f297fd2261b57d5178656e2af3452fb1601
spent
true